Warning

• Failure to observe the instructions on cleaning

the unit and changing the filters will cause a
fire hazard. You are therefore strongly
recommended to follow these instructions.

• The manufacturer declines all responsibility

for any damage to the motor or any fire
damage linked to inappropriate maintenance
or failure to observe the above safety
recommendations.

Changing the light bulb(s)

Disconnect the cooker hood from the
mains supply.

• Prior to touching the light bulbs ensure

they are cooled down.

• Remove the grease filters to access light

bulbs area.

• Replace the old bulb with a new one of the

same type.

• Refit the grease filters.
• If the light does not come on, make sure the

bulb has been inserted in correctly before
contacting your local Service Force Centre.

Cleaning the hood

• Clean the outside of the hood using a damp cloth and a solution of water and mild washing up

liquid.

• Never use corrosive, abrasive or flammable cleaning products or products containing bleach.
• Never insert pointed objects in the motor’s protective grid.
• Only ever clean the switch panel and filter grill using a damp cloth and mild washing up liquid.

• Clean all the plastic parts with a soft cloth soaked in warm water and neutral soap.

• It is extremely important to clean the unit and change the filters at the recommended intervals.

Failure to do so will cause grease deposits to build up that could constitute a fire hazard.
